#UKToSuspendCryptoPoliticalDonations
The United Kingdom has taken a significant step by announcing a suspension of cryptoasset political donations. This decision reflects a growing scrutiny over how digital currencies are utilized within the political sphere, aiming to enhance transparency and align with existing stringent regulations on financial contributions. The move comes at a time when global instability, marked by ongoing conflicts and heightened geopolitical tensions, has placed additional pressure on financial systems and intensified debates around the traceability of funds. Meanwhile, cryptocurrency markets have experienced notable price fluctuations, further drawing attention to the need for responsible adoption and robust oversight. Against this backdrop, the suspension signals a pivotal moment where the conversation is shifting from mere adoption to responsible integration within established systems. While the suspension introduces short term uncertainty for political entities that have embraced digital assets, it also opens the door for developing clearer frameworks that could ultimately legitimize crypto donations in the long run.
